The bookies are rarely wrong, so who do they think will win their groups?
Group A
Despite Portgual's poor start with a draw against Finland, the bookies still have them as favourites at 10/11, 5/6. Quite suprisingly they have Serbia as second favourites at around 2/1 to 19/4. In third they generally have Poland at between 7/1 to 10/1.
Group B
It's no shock that the smart money is on France with odds that range from 8/13 to 4/6. In second sport the bookmakers generally put Italy despite the fact that they've only secured one point out of a possible six.
Ukraine are listed as third with odds that range from 9/2 to 5/1 and Scotland are fourth favourites with long odds of 20/1 or 50/1 with SkyBet.
Group C
Greece are favourites just ahead of Turkey with odds of around 7/4 and 2/1. Norway are third with just slightly longer odds with Hungary way out at fourth will odds that range from 10/1 to 20/1.
Group D
There are no suprises with Germany the more likely to win the group. They have odds of between 4/6 and 8/13. The Czech Republic are listed 2nd with marginally longer odds. The Republic of Ireland are further out with odds of around 8/1 to 10/1.
Wales are fourth favourites with odds of between 33/1 to a staggering 100/1 with Sky Bet.
If you want to waste your money you could try a flutter on San Marino with odds of 20,000 I'm not sure you'll be getting anything back!
Group E
There's a fair bit of variation with the bookies for odds for the Group E winners. All have England as favourites with odds ranking from 3/1 to 4/11. Croatia are second favourites with odds of 4/1 to 5/1. Russia are third favourites with the suprise team so far Israel fourth favourite.
Group F
Despite their recent loss Spain are listed at around Evens, whilst current group leaders Sweden are second favourites at around 6/4 to 2/1. Denmark are third at around 3/1 and Iceland range from 50/1 to 120/1.
Group G
Holland are firm favourites with odds of 1/3 to 4/11. Then way back there is Romania at around 4/1, Bulgaria 5/1 and Slovenia 20/1 to 33/1.
